I have noticed when following the checklist until just before engine start up, the engine ECU switch does not work anymore.
There is no engine read out from ECU to see, when thrust lever can be moved to idle and engine can start.
Avionics must be on to see ECU info. Maybe Bert can fix it?

Send me a PM with the details, and I'll have a look :cool:

Edit:

Just looked.. if you are OK with editing xml files, using Notepad:

1. Search for "GTN_MFD" in your panel folder

2. Open this xml file with Notepad and search for "Power"

3. Replace the Power MacroValue with this:

        <MacroValue>(A:ELECTRICAL MASTER BATTERY,BOOL)  (A:CIRCUIT GENERAL PANEL ON, bool) and </MacroValue>
     

4. Save and try it!
